The Core Components
A well-rounded deck must possess specific tools to handle a wide variety of threats you will encounter on the ladder.

Every successful deck revolves around a primary 'Win Condition'—the specific card designed to reliably damage the enemy tower.

A high average cost (above 4.0) is a 'Beatdown Deck', designed to build one massive, unstoppable push during double elixir time.

If your deck is too heavy, you will sit defenseless while the opponent chips away at your towers with cheap, fast attacks.
